Peoplebank Intermedium Federal Labour Hire Index: November 2010
As at June 2010, the Index stood at 1,316, a 141 point increase in the six months since the December 2009 figure (1,175) and an increase of 12.2% over the half year. On July 19th 2010 Peoplebank lodged a scheme of arrangement offer with the ASX to acquire major Australian recruitment company Ross Human Directions (RHD). RHD shareholders will vote on the scheme of arrangement on the 14th October 2010, to be successful 75% of RHD shareholders must approve the acquisition.
